#bf6e78 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f6e78 is composed of 74.9% red, 43.1%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.4% magenta, 37.2%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 352.6 degrees, a saturation of 38.8% and a lightness of 59%. #bf6e78 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dcf0 with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#bf6e78
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050202 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f6e78
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979696 is the less saturated color, while #f7364e is the most saturated one.
